AN EGYPTIAN STEATITE 'ROYAL' SCARAB, INSCRIBED FOR THE SON OF RE, SHESHI, MAY HE LIVE FOREVER
HYKSOS PERIOD, DYNASTY XV, CIRCA 1675-1565 B.C.
AN EGYPTIAN STEATITE 'ROYAL' SCARAB, INSCRIBED FOR THE SON OF RE, SHESHI, MAY HE LIVE FOREVER HYKSOS PERIOD, DYNASTY XV, CIRCA 1675-1565 B.C. The cartouche flanked by two ankh -signs, 7/8 in. (2.1 cm.) long; a steatite scarab, reverse Men-kheper-ra (Tuthmosis III), lord of Truth; a steatite plaque of Men-kheper-ra, rev. winged protector over horse(?); a mud seal impression, all New Kingdom, 15th Century B.C., 5/8 in. (1.6 cm.) max.; a group of 29 2nd-1st millennium B.C. steatite scarabs and cowroids, comprising a scarab, rev . The Chamberlain, Ib, Dynasty XII, circa 1991-1786 B.C.; scarab, rev. standing Bes within concentric rings; scarab, rev. good luck signs; another similar; scarab, rev. five concentric rings; face scarab, rev. conjoining circles, Second Intermediate Period, 1786-1550 B.C.; scarab, rev. lion; scarab, rev. papyrus motif; cowroid, rev. cartouche kheper-ka , flanked by ankh , bird and wedjat -eye; cowroid, rev. scarab flanked by ankh, nsw and nefer -signs, with nwb gold sign above, all Middle Kingdom-Second Intermediate Period; cowroid, rev. female name; rosette, rev. frog; rosette, rev. conjoined lotus petals; cowroid, rev. scarab, gold and good luck signs; scarab, rev. concubine; scarab, rev. kheper-ra ...; scarab, rev. uraei and repetitive water and oval signs; plaque, rev. winged cobra protecting wings, wearing elaborate crown, supporting seated figure of sun-god; scarab, rev. hunter smiting a scorpion, quadruped and antelope; scarab, rev. figure holding up two "creatures of the desert"; scarab, rev. man holding up two lizards; scarab, rev. User-maat-ra (Ramesses II); plaque, rev. two lions, a tree, a horse; scarab, rev. seated baboon sniffing a lotus flower on either side of the sun disc, two seated deities above, winged scarab below; lion seal, rev. lion (ti-ma'y); frog seal, rev. Men-kheper-ra (Tuthmosis III); frit scarab, rev. sistrum; another, rev. praying monkey; and a wooden cowroid, rev. cross-hatching, all Dynasty XVIII-XX, 1550-1070 B.C., ¾ in. (2 cm.) long max. (33)
